Default So this happened to my Z...

Working the graveyard shift and operating a Z after work on zero sleep do not mix well. I usually take this merge lane right turn at about 50 without incident. The one time I take it sleep deprived, and at the same speed as usual, I give it too much throttle on corner exit and spin it. I caused 4500 dollars in damage to my poor Z This happened on 10-4 in the morning and the body shop wont have my car ready until 10-25. This blows! Fortunately nobody was injured at all. I will save the spirited driving for when I'm wide awake from now on, haha.

As a side note, I always make sure I have the green light and check for bikers and pedestrians (there is a clean line of sight all the way up through the turn so I can see if anyone or anything is there).
